2026 WCQ: NFF Charges Super Eagles to Beat Rwanda, Zimbabwe

On Friday, the Super Eagles will face Rwanda's Amavubi at the Amahoro Stadium in Kigali, hoping to clinch their first win in the qualifiers.

The Nigeria Football Federation (NFF) has urged the Super Eagles to win their forthcoming 2026 FIFA World Cup qualifying matches against Rwanda and Zimbabwe.

On Friday, the Super Eagles will face Rwanda’s Amavubi at the Amahoro Stadium in Kigali, hoping to clinch their first win in the qualifiers.

Eric Chelle’s team will also face the Warriors of Zimbabwe at the Godswill Akpabio International Stadium in Uyo next week Tuesday.

With the Super Eagles sitting in fifth position in Group C with three points from four games, NFF stated that it is important for the team to secure maximum points from the two games.

The body also demanded total support for the team in their quest to qualify for the World Cup.

“The executive committee charged the players to go all out for the six points in both matches to boost Nigeria’s qualification hopes,” reads a communique at the end of the NFF executive meeting.

“It also called on all Nigerians to support and encourage the team in whatever fair and proper way they are competent to, in order to guarantee victory in both matches.”
